Output f3eeb496542d93daff361664a0a1324cb9967ef5b90eb604619f5127e180d47c:34

value
28599626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88f41473039ff1ff149e6da9173132b9285276c6 OP_EQUAL
address
MLPJXVApyFUjC3qdyja3VyR37fXLRzEZph
transaction
f3eeb496542d93daff361664a0a1324cb9967ef5b90eb604619f5127e180d47c
spent
true